About Living in Fabens, Texas

Fabens is located in Texas and has an overall cost of living that is -22% compared to the national average. Understanding the full picture of living expenses — from housing and rent to grocery bills and healthcare — is essential when considering a move to Fabens.

Housing: Median rent in Fabens is $584.19 / month, and the median home price is $194,655. Housing costs are -64% compared to the national average, which significantly impacts monthly budgets.

Groceries: Daily essentials like bread ($4.00), milk ($4.64), and eggs ($4.58) reflect the local grocery landscape. Overall grocery costs are -2% vs the national average.

Healthcare: Medical costs include doctor visits ($150.91), dentist visits ($121.22), and prescription drugs ($21.85). These costs should be factored into your monthly budget when planning a move.

Texas has no state income tax, which means residents of Fabens keep more of their earnings. This is especially beneficial for high-income earners and retirees.
